Definitions of pensive in English
Adjective(1) deeply or seriously thoughtful(2) showing pensive sadness
Examples of pensive in English
(1) The pensive mood is punctuated by the quiet string-pluck of an acoustic guitar at the end of the track.(2) Julia is interrupted from her thoughts when a pensive looking Greg steps up behind her.(3) His fingers oscillated between F# and D Major, as he looked outside from window in a pensive mood.(4) The film has a lush look, several scenes shot in late evening, the mood lightly pensive .(5) The eerie stillness of the music and voice reflects the pensive , self-critical nature of the lyric.(6) Rich had become so absorbed in his pensive gazing that he failed to notice his brother enter the cafÔö£┬«.(7) I suppose you can all see that I have managed to ditch the pensive mood I was in when I made my previous post.(8) Our mood turns pensive as we find the rental shop and return our scooters.(9) His dark eyes were pensive , almost thoughtful, and they were directly aimed at me.(10) He smiled to himself, for he had once again caught his sister in a pensive mood.(11) It makes me think that she's just fairly introverted and is quite a thoughtful person, even pensive perhaps.(12) He was still a serious pensive boy but slightly older, he didn't run so much, nor did he stare around him.(13) Nicole glanced over at Jake and saw his pensive mood written all over his face.(14) When you're in a pensive mood, as I have been today, the British weather can be a fine accompaniment.(15) With a pensive mood, he felt as if the moon was addressing him, and the stars enticing him to answer back.(16) He asked the question as if he were serious, his face pensive as if he were really trying to figure it out.
